Applications
1,1,1-Trifluoroacetone is used in a synthesis of 2-trifluoromethyl-7-azaindoles starting with 2,6-dihalopyridines. The derived chiral imine was used to prepare enantiopure α-trifluoromethyl alanines and diamines via a Strecker reaction followed by either nitrile hydrolysis or reduction. And also used as a useful molecule in synthesis reactions.

Chemical Identifiers

CAS 421-50-1
Molecular Formula C3H3F3O
Molecular Weight (g/mol) 112.051
MDL Number MFCD00000423
InChI Key FHUDAMLDXFJHJE-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Synonym 1,1,1-trifluoroacetone, trifluoroacetone, 1,1,1-trifluoro-2-propanone, methyl trifluoromethyl ketone, 2-propanone, 1,1,1-trifluoro, trifluoromethyl methyl ketone, 3,3,3-trifluoroacetone, 1,1,1,-trifluoroacetone, trifluoroketone, trifluoracetone
PubChem CID 9871
IUPAC Name 1,1,1-trifluoropropan-2-one
SMILES CC(=O)C(F)(F)F

Specifications

Melting Point <-78°C
Density 1.252
Boiling Point 21°C to 24°C
Flash Point −31°C (−24°F)
Odor Chloroform-like
Refractive Index 1.3
